  • Patent number: 4632934
    Abstract: The imidazole derivatives of the formula: ##STR1## wherein R is a hydrogen atom or an alkyl group, A.sub.1 and A.sub.2, which may be the same or different, each is an alkylene or an alkylene group, m is 0 or 1, and Z is ##STR2## wherein R.sub.1 and R.sub.2, which may be the same or different, each is a hydrogen atom or an alkyl group, and the terminal carbon atom bonded to the hetero atom of Z may be bonded to either A.sub.1 or A.sub.2 or COOR group (in the case of m being 0); and the pharmaceutically acceptable salts thereof. These compounds have a strong inhibitory effect on thromboxane synthetase from human or bovine platelet microsomes, and are useful as therapeutically actives for inflammation, hypertension, thrombus, cerebral apoplexy and asthma.

  • Patent number: 4320134
    Abstract: The imidazole compounds of the general formula (I): ##STR1## wherein Y is a carboxyl group, a hydroxymethyl group, an N-di or -mono alkyl substituted or unsubstituted carbamoyl group, a cyano group, or an N-di or -mono alkyl substituted or unsubstituted aminomethyl group, and n is an integer of 3 to 20; and pharmaceutically acceptable salts thereof. These compounds have a strong inhibitory effect on thromboxane synthetase from rabbit platelet microsomes, and are useful as therapeutically active agents for inflammation, hypertension, thrombus, cerebral apoplexy and asthma.

  • Patent number: 4226878
    Abstract: Novel imidazole derivatives of the general formula (I): ##STR1## wherein Y is a carboxyl group, an alkoxycarbonyl group, a cyano group, a hydroxymethyl group, an aminomethyl group, a formyl group or a carbamoyl group, and A and B, which may be the same or different, each is a straight- or branched-chain alkylene or alkenylene group, and n and m, which may be the same or different, each is zero or 1, with the proviso that when A is methylene group or n is zero, m is 1; and pharmaceutically acceptable salts thereof. These compounds have a strong inhibitory effect on thromboxane synthetase from rabbit platelet microsomes, and are useful as therapeutically active agents for the treatment of inflammation, hypertension, thrombus, cerebral apoplexy and asthma.
